
C++小问题
半亩园
自信人生二百年,会当水击三千里。
展开
-
vector<pair<int, int> >的排序问题
在写代码的时候,需要将一个存了一些key-value的数组进行排序,于是用到了这个东西。#include <utility>#include <iostream>#include <vector>#include <algorithm>using namespace std;typedef pair<int, int> score;vector<pair<int, int> > score_matrix原创 2020-08-12 20:31:53 · 4616 阅读 · 0 评论 -
C++写文件
在调试程序的时候,有一些关键的信息,需要写在文件中,以便于对代码执行过程进行检查,并对参数进行调整,所以在这里记录下C++写文件的代码。#include<fstream>#include<iostream>using namespace std;int main(){ ofstream OutFile("Test.txt"); OutFile << "This is a Test12!"<<endl; OutFile <&原创 2020-08-12 20:19:19 · 389 阅读 · 0 评论 -
找不到头文件--两种include方式区别
今天在改代码的时候,自己加进去一个头文件,然而,在编译的时候,提示找不到头文件,反复确认头文件名称没敲错,路径没问题,然而还是不行,更让我疑惑的是编译器居然可以自动补全头文件的名字。真是奇怪了。后来在这里找到了答案,是关于#include<> 和 #include “” 的使用方法的不同。#include<> 引用的是编译器的类库路径里面的头文件。标准库文件一般都放...原创 2019-11-30 14:41:21 · 5356 阅读 · 0 评论